Cedarville's pest activity is shaped by the combination of village housing, college-related movement, and the wooded and agricultural land around Massies Creek. Homes and rentals near the village center may see different pest issues than larger lots outside town, because student housing, visitor traffic, furniture movement, and frequent occupancy changes can introduce pests while creekside vegetation supports outdoor insect activity. Cedarville is near Xenia, Yellow Springs, Springfield, and Dayton, but its pest pattern is more tied to institutional turnover and creek-valley edges than to large suburban shopping corridors.
Bed bugs can become a concern where travel, used furnishings, and shared housing overlap. Mice may enter older rentals and homes through utility openings, crawl space gaps, and attached garages, especially when storage areas stay undisturbed between semesters or seasons. Ants and spiders often increase where moisture, leaf litter, and exterior lighting create steady insect activity around foundations and porches. For Cedarville properties, inspection should account for how the building is occupied as much as how it is constructed.
